.reg-f{text-align:right;width:45%;color:#de2018;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7;vertical-align:top}

.reg-comp{padding:5;border:#c7c7c7 1px solid;background-color:#d8e8f6}
.reg-comp-lt{text-align:right;width:45%;color:#000000;padding-right:20;padding-bottom:7;padding-top:7;border-top:#c7c7c7 1px solid;border-left:#c7c7c7 1px solid;background-color:#d8e8f6}
.reg-comp-rt{text-align:left;width:55%;color:#de2018;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7;background-color:#d8e8f6;border-top:#c7c7c7 1px solid;border-right:#c7c7c7 1px solid}
.reg-comp-lb{text-align:right;width:45%;color:#000000;padding-right:20;padding-bottom:7;padding-top:7;background-color:#d8e8f6;border-left:#c7c7c7 1px solid;border-bottom:#c7c7c7 1px solid;}
.reg-comp-rb{text-align:left;width:55%;color:#de2018;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7;background-color:#d8e8f6;border-bottom:#c7c7c7 1px solid;border-right:#c7c7c7 1px solid}

.reg-n2{text-align:left;color:#000000;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7;padding-left:10;width:25%}
.reg-n{text-align:right;color:#000000;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7}
.reg-v{text-align:right;width:45%;color:#000000;padding-right:20;padding-bottom:7;padding-top:7}

.reg-radio{text-align:left;color:#000000;font-weight:bold}
.reg-c{text-align:left;width:55%;color:#c7c7c7;font-weight:bold;padding-right:20;padding-bottom:7;padding-top:7}
.reg-t{width:100%;color:#000000; border-bottom: #c7c7c7 2px solid;padding-bottom:11;padding-right:24}
.textfield-r{width:260;border:#c7c7c7 1px solid}
.textfield-day{width:20;border:#c7c7c7 1px solid}
.textfield-year{width:40;border:#c7c7c7 1px solid}

.foto{border:#c7c7c7 1px solid;width:50%}
